Renault and Nissan are gearing up for a major comeback in India. After years of limited product updates, both brands are set to launch three all-new models by June 2026. The upcoming line-up will include two SUVs and one MPV, marking their biggest product push in the Indian market in recent years.

Nissan will reveal a new sub-4 metre MPV on December 18, 2025. The MPV has been developed mainly for Indian customers. It is expected to be priced between Rs 5.75 lakh and Rs 6 lakh (ex-showroom). Deliveries are likely to start in January 2026.
Triber-Based MPV With Minor Design Changes
The new Nissan MPV will be based on the Renault Triber. While the overall shape will remain similar, Nissan will offer small visual changes. These include redesigned bumpers, a new front grille, different 15-inch alloy wheels, and revised headlamp and tail lamp designs.
Flexible 7-Seater Cabin
Inside, the MPV will see limited updates, mainly in colours and trim. It will come with a 2+3+2 seating layout. The third-row seats will be removable, helping increase boot space when fewer passengers are onboard.
Renault will launch the all-new third-generation Duster in India on January 26, 2026. This will be Renault’s first completely new model in the country in five years. The SUV will feature a tough yet modern exterior design.
Upgraded Interior and Safety Features
The new Duster’s cabin will be much more premium than before. It is expected to offer modern features and a cleaner layout. Higher variants may get Level 2 ADAS for improved safety.
Petrol Engines at Launch, Hybrid Later
Renault is likely to launch the new Duster with 1.0-litre and 1.3-litre turbo petrol engines in February 2026. A hybrid version of the Duster is planned for India by early 2027.
Nissan is also working on a Duster-based SUV called the Tekton. It is expected to launch in June 2026. While it will share the same platform and engines as the Duster, it will get a more aggressive design with connected DRLs, connected tail lights, and a bold model name on the bonnet. The interior and mechanical setup of the Tekton are expected to remain largely the same as the Renault Duster.
